A fascinating look at the founders of the world's main religions.
The major religious traditions of the world owe their existence to
the vision of an ancient founder. This important volume explores
the lives of the five founders of major world religions-Moses,
Buddha, Confucius, Jesus, and Muhammad-chronicling what is actually
known of these charismatic men and introducing readers to the
cultural and religious worlds that heard their messages. Readers in
predominantly Christian lands, in addition to learning about the
lives of Confucius, Buddha, and Muhammad- whom they might not be
familiar with- will also be introduced to modern research now
casting fresh light on the careers of Moses and Jesus. Whether
studied individually or in comparison with one another, these
biographies, together with a chapter on the characteristics of
religious leadership, chart the spiritual rivers that continue to
feed the diversity of religious expression today.
